Sal Rei
Some fishermen and their friends launch their boat from the little island of Sal Rei, Boa Vista.
The town in the background is also called Sal Rei. The name means Salt King. Until the advent of refrigeration salt was a very important commodity, and the salt pans which lay beside the little town were very important to the Portuguese economy.
